Almond Kisses

By: Bella  
"A delicious, traditional Swedish cookie."

Original Recipe Yield 2 dozen
 

Ingredients

  • 2 cups almonds
  • 2 egg whites
  • 1 cup packed br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ons sifted all-purpose flour

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 300 degrees F. Grease cookie sheets.
  2. Chop almonds into 5 or 6 pieces each and set aside.
  3. Separate eggs and whip egg whites until stiff. Fold in brown sugar, flour and almonds. Stir lightly.
  4. Drop by teaspoonfuls onto cookie sheets and bake about 30 minutes.
